L.E.A.F. in the Community

One of the best things about living in Las Vegas is beautiful Red Rock Canyon  right in our backyard. This past weekend, some of us LEAFers went on a hike and cleaned  up the trail along the way. The weather was perfect, the trail was empty, and we couldn't have asked for better company. One of our LEAFers, Amelia, even brought her two pups along for the day. We went back as far as we could before the trail got a little questionable, found our way down to the creek running partially alongside the trail, and enjoyed ourselves a nice little snack!  

community, community involvement, earth day, ecofriendly, environmentally friendly, hiking, L.E.A.F., red rock canyon, stewardship, The Zappos Family, trail clean-up, zappos culture, Zappos goes Green

Although this event may not be what you consider environmental stewardship, it still provided some important lessons about how to be more environmentally aware. Spending your time outdoors is much better for the environment by reducing the amount of electricity we use and carbon emissions we produce. We also learned how to respect the outdoors by cleaning up after our dogs, not spitting our seeds or shells onto the ground, and not to pick anything up that is native to the area.  Oh, and cigarettes are not biodegradable, (contrary to what some people may think!). All these things will help protect the beautiful outdoors. We were able to provide a small service to the land by picking up any waste we found along the way. Surprisingly, there wasn't much! But, we still accumulated a small amount of cigarette butts and pistachios shells.
